Background

USB provides an expandable, hot-pluggable Plug and Play serial interface that ensures a standard, low-cost connection for peripheral devices such as storage devices, keyboards, joysticks, printers, scanners, modems, and digital cameras.

USB is natively supported in almost all desktop operating systems (Windows, Linux) while other embedded operating systems or firmware that need USB support require a dedicated USB stack, available from Jungo.

The Jungo USB Host stack consists of three logical layers communicating through two interfaces. The upper layer is the Device Driver layer, representing the different class drivers. The other two layers are responsible for abstracting the USB device to this device driver layer. These layers are the USB Driver layer (USBD) and the Host Controller Driver layer (HCD).

Specification
  • Product description: USB 1.1/2.0 Host Stack
  • Support for USB Controllers in discrete and IP forms
  • Support for assorted USB Controller interfaces including: PCI, Local Bus etc.
  • Support for Static/Dynamic Memory - the stack utilizes its native memory pool management mechanism to ensure memory leaks are neutralized.

  • USB 1.1 and USB 2.0 transfer rates:
    High-speed (480 Mb/s), full-speed (12 Mb/s) and low-speed (1.5 Mb/s)
  • Control, Bulk, Interrupt and Isochronous data transfer support
